If you’ve been searching for modern web hosting, you may wonder: what is Pantheon?
Pantheon is a WebOps platform and managed hosting provider that focuses on WordPress and Drupal websites. Built on container-based infrastructure, Pantheon delivers high performance, security, and developer-friendly workflows.

In this blog, we’ll explore what Pantheon is, its features, advantages, disadvantages, pricing insights, and who should use it.


What is Pantheon Hosting?

Pantheon is more than just a hosting service. It combines infrastructure, developer tools, and workflows in one platform. It offers multiple environments (Dev, Test, Live, Multidev), built-in caching and CDN, Git version control, and automated backups.

Because of these features, many agencies, enterprises, and developers choose Pantheon for professional-grade WordPress and Drupal projects.


Key Features of Pantheon

FeatureWhy It Matters
Multiple EnvironmentsWork in Dev, Test, and Live safely. Use Multidev for feature branches without touching production.
Container InfrastructureEach site runs in isolated containers for stability and scalability.
Developer ToolsIncludes Git workflows, Pantheon CLI (Terminus), and collaboration tools.
Performance & CDNBuilt-in caching and a global CDN ensure faster load times.
SecuritySSL certificates, daily backups, and hardened infrastructure.

Advantages of Pantheon

  • 🚀 High reliability and uptime
  • 🛠 Developer-friendly workflows with Git and staging
  • ⚡ Performance boosts from CDN and caching
  • 📞 Responsive support and documentation
  • 🌍 Ideal for agencies managing multiple sites

Disadvantages of Pantheon

  • 💰 Higher cost compared to shared hosting
  • 📚 Steeper learning curve for beginners
  • 🔒 Limited server customization compared to VPS
  • 🌍 No built-in domain registration
  • 📈 Costs may increase with traffic spikes

Pantheon vs Other Hosting

FactorPantheonShared HostingVPS/Dedicated
PerformanceHigh with container-based infraLow to mediumHigh but needs manual tuning
Developer ToolsGit, multidev, stagingMinimalFull but requires sysadmin skills
Ease of UseModerate, suited for developersBeginner-friendlyComplex, technical knowledge needed
CostHigherLowerVaries widely

FAQs

What is Pantheon used for?
Pantheon is used for hosting and managing WordPress and Drupal websites with professional workflows.

Does Pantheon support my own domain?
Yes, but you need to purchase the domain separately.

How many environments are available?
You get Dev, Test, and Live by default. Enterprise plans include Multidev.

Is Pantheon expensive?
It costs more than shared hosting, but it includes premium features like CDN, caching, and automated workflows.
